Real Madrid Vs Osasuna - Preview and Prediction,
Overview:
Jose Mourinho was denied a perfect start to his managerial career at Madrid as Mallorca kept Madrid at bay a fortnight ago. Dudu Aouate, Mallorca’s keeper had a big part to play as he made several vital saves to keep his side level. As for Osasuna, Jose Antonio Camacho kicked start the season with a draw at home against Almeria.

Despite the draw, there are some positives for Mourinho. Both Benzema and Higuain did well for their national side by netting a goal each during the International week. With both these duo looking sharp and Ronaldo returning to fitness, there should not be much for Mourinho to complain about.

Jose Mourinho will welcome back Ronaldo as his fellow countryman recovered from his injury he sustained a fortnight ago. However he will be without Kaka, Gago, Albiol and Garay who are all out injured.

With Mourinho’s side not clicking well against Mallorca, it is highly likely that there will be several changes to the starting line up. Angel Di Maria and Sergio Canales are likely to be dropped to the bench and will be replaced by probably Ozil and Benzema or Khedira. On the other hand, Pepe who has yet to play a competitive game for Madrid since last December should replace Alvaro Arbeloa in defense.

Antonio Camacho believes that his side have what it takes to take all three points away from Madrid as his side have led at the Santiago Bernabau three times in the last two seasons. However, leading is one thing while winning the game is another.

With Osasuna having a poor pre-season, losing five out of their eight friendly games and winning only once, they look unconvincing against Almeria a fortnight ago. With a lack of goal scoring edge by Osasuna hitting the target only twice in the entire game against Almeria and poor communication in defense, Madrid might just have a walk in the park.

Camacho will be relying on the experience of Walter Pandiani to get him the goals. However with Pandiani at 34 this year, i doubt that he could outrun this Madrid defense BUT i have to say, Pandiani will be a threat during set pieces.

Probable Lineups:
Real Madrid : Casillas, Ramos, Carvalho, Pepe, Marcelo, Xabi Alonso, Khedira, Ozil, Ronaldo, Benzema and Higuain.
Osasuna: Ricardo, Joseto, Sergio, Nacho, Damia, Punal, Sorinao, Camunas, Juanfran, Pandiani and Aranda

Head to head:
Recent head to head suggest that Real Madrid does have the upper hand against Osasuna. In their last 10 meetings, Real Madrid have won seven, drawing two and losing only one.
